|
@@ -70,7 +70,7 @@ public class EnterpriseGroupVertex extends
|
|
|
if (!getValue().isSendMsg()) {
|
|
|
for (String destVertexId : vertexInfo.getHoldCompanyId()) {
|
|
|
//传递控股企业
|
|
|
- EntGroupMsg entGroupMsg = EntGroupMsg.ofByType_1(getId(), getValue().getCompanyName(), getValue().getCompanyType(), vertexInfo.getNotHoldCompanyId());
|
|
|
+ EntGroupMsg entGroupMsg = EntGroupMsg.ofByType_1(getId(), getValue().getCompanyName(), getValue().getCompanyType(), vertexInfo.getNotHoldKeyno());
|
|
|
boolean flag = entGroupMsg.routeLog(destVertexId);
|
|
|
if (!flag) {
|
|
|
// getValue().setOutput();
|
|
@@ -98,7 +98,7 @@ public class EnterpriseGroupVertex extends
|
|
|
if (vertexInfo.getHoldCompanyId().isEmpty()) {
|
|
|
//如果没有控股企业,则本节点为集团,需将本节点的参股股东,添加至集团股东
|
|
|
List<String> groupHolderCompanyIds = getValue().getGroupHolderCompanyIds().tuple2List();
|
|
|
- groupHolderCompanyIds.addAll(vertexInfo.getNotHoldCompanyId());
|
|
|
+ groupHolderCompanyIds.addAll(vertexInfo.getNotHoldKeyno());
|
|
|
getValue().setGroupHolderCompanyIds(groupHolderCompanyIds);
|
|
|
}
|
|
|
|
|
@@ -298,13 +298,23 @@ public class EnterpriseGroupVertex extends
|
|
|
}
|
|
|
|
|
|
for (String e : groupHolderCompanyId) {
|
|
|
- context.write(
|
|
|
- "relation"
|
|
|
- , new Text(enterprise_group_hold_company_id + "_3_" + e)
|
|
|
- , enterprise_group_hold_company_id
|
|
|
- , new Text("3")
|
|
|
- , new Text(e)
|
|
|
- );
|
|
|
+ if(e.length()==32){
|
|
|
+ context.write(
|
|
|
+ "relation"
|
|
|
+ , new Text(enterprise_group_hold_company_id + "_3_" + e)
|
|
|
+ , enterprise_group_hold_company_id
|
|
|
+ , new Text("3")
|
|
|
+ , new Text(e)
|
|
|
+ );
|
|
|
+ }else{
|
|
|
+ context.write(
|
|
|
+ "relation"
|
|
|
+ , new Text(enterprise_group_hold_company_id + "_4_" + e)
|
|
|
+ , enterprise_group_hold_company_id
|
|
|
+ , new Text("4")
|
|
|
+ , new Text(e)
|
|
|
+ );
|
|
|
+ }
|
|
|
}
|
|
|
|
|
|
}
|